Catalog description
This course provides students with knowledge and understanding of digital logic functions in industrial applications. Topics of study include combinational logic circuits, flip-flops, counters, registers and semiconductor memory devices.

Section notes
Students must attend a combination of face-to-face meetings on campus as listed on the course schedule and regularly participate in online instructional activities but not at designated, specific times. The course syllabus and instructional materials are provided online. Exams may be proctored during the scheduled class meeting times or using remote proctoring software online. A computer, high-speed internet, web camera and microphone are needed for Hybrid courses. Students who do not have access to this technology may use the computer labs available on campus.
